Degaon Bk. Population - Nanded, Maharashtra

Degaon Bk. is a large village located in Deglur Taluka of Nanded district, Maharashtra with total 494 families residing. The Degaon Bk. village has population of 2480 of which 1246 are males while 1234 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Degaon Bk. village population of children with age 0-6 is 324 which makes up 13.06 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Degaon Bk. village is 990 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Degaon Bk. as per census is 1025,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.

Degaon Bk. village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Degaon Bk. village was 73.42 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Degaon Bk. Male literacy stands at 82.41 % while female literacy rate was 64.30 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 9.72 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.93 % of total population in Degaon Bk. village.

Work Profile

In Degaon Bk. village out of total population, 1123 were engaged in work activities. 63.49 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 36.51 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1123 workers engaged in Main Work, 187 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 415 were Agricultural labourer.
